717 resultados para controllers


Relevância:

10.00% 10.00%

Publicador:

Resumo:

The general stability theory of nonlinear receding horizon controllers has attracted much attention over the last fifteen years, and many algorithms have been proposed to ensure closed-loop stability. On the other hand many reports exist regarding the use of artificial neural network models in nonlinear receding horizon control. However, little attention has been given to the stability issue of these specific controllers. This paper addresses this problem and proposes to cast the nonlinear receding horizon control based on neural network models within the framework of an existing stabilising algorithm.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Intelligent viewing systems are required if efficient and productive teleoperation is to be applied to dynamic manufacturing environments. These systems must automatically provide remote views to an operator which assist in the completion of the task. This assistance increases the productivity of the teleoperation task if the robot controller is responsive to the unpredictable dynamic evolution of the workcell. Behavioral controllers can be utilized to give reactive 'intelligence.' The inherent complex structure of current systems, however, places considerable time overheads on any redesign of the emergent behavior. In industry, where the remote environment and task frequently change, this continual redesign process becomes inefficient. We introduce a novel behavioral controller, based on an 'ego-behavior' architecture, to command an active camera (a camera mounted on a robot) within a remote workcell. Using this ego-behavioral architecture the responses from individual behaviors are rapidly combined to produce an 'intelligent' responsive viewing system. The architecture is single-layered, each behavior being autonomous with no explicit knowledge of the number, description or activity of other behaviors present (if any). This lack of imposed structure decreases the development time as it allows each behavior to be designed and tested independently before insertion into the architecture. The fusion mechanism for the behaviors provides the ability for each behavior to compete and/or co-operate with other behaviors for full or partial control of the viewing active camera. Each behavior continually reassesses this degree of competition or co-operation by measuring its own success in controlling the active camera against pre-defined constraints. The ego-behavioral architecture is demonstrated through simulation and experimentation.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

The robot control problem is discussed with regard to controller implementation on a multitransputer array. Some high-performance aspects required of such controllers are described, with particular reference to robot force control. The implications for the architecture required for controllers based on computed torque are discussed and an example is described. The idea of treating a transputer array as a virtual bus is put forward for the implementation of fast real-time controllers. An example is given of controlling a Puma 560 industrial robot. Some of the practical considerations for using transputers for such control are described.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

Paraplegic subjects lack trunk stability due to the loss of voluntary muscle control.This leads to a restriction of the volume of bi-manual workspace available,and hence has a detrimental impact on activities of daily living. Electrical Stimulation of paralysed muscles can be used to stabilize the trunk, but has never been applied in closed loop for this purpose. This paper describes the development of two closed loop controllers(PID and LQR),and their experimental evaluation on a human subject. Advantages and disadvantages of the two are discussed,considering a potential use of this technology during daily activities.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This work proposes a method to objectively determine the most suitable analogue redesign method for forward type converters under digital voltage mode control. Particular emphasis is placed on determining the method which allows the highest phase margin at the particular switching and crossover frequencies chosen by the designer. It is shown that at high crossover frequencies with respect to switching frequency, controllers designed using backward integration have the largest phase margin; whereas at low crossover frequencies with respect to switching frequency, controllers designed using bilinear integration have the largest phase margins. An accurate model of the power stage is used for simulation, and experimental results from a Buck converter are collected. The performance of the digital controllers is compared to that of the equivalent analogue controller both in simulation and experiment. Excellent correlation between the simulation and experimental results is presented. This work will allow designers to confidently choose the analogue redesign method which yields the greater phase margin for their application.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

A MATLAB GUI is presented which is used to help students learn to design controllers in the frequency domain. It complements the author’s two previous GUIs for plotting and identification of systems in the frequency domain. It also incorporates the concept used in the “electronic calculator that makes students think” to assist learning. Positive student feedback affirms that the GUI has helped their understanding.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This article proposes a systematic approach to determine the most suitable analogue redesign method to be used for forward-type converters under digital voltage mode control. The focus of the method is to achieve the highest phase margin at the particular switching and crossover frequencies chosen by the designer. It is shown that at high crossover frequencies with respect to switching frequency, controllers designed using backward integration have the largest phase margin; whereas at low crossover frequencies with respect to switching frequency, controllers designed using bilinear integration with pre-warping have the largest phase margins. An algorithm has been developed to determine the frequency of the crossing point where the recommended discretisation method changes. An accurate model of the power stage is used for simulation and experimental results from a Buck converter are collected. The performance of the digital controllers is compared to that of the equivalent analogue controller both in simulation and experiment. Excellent closeness between the simulation and experimental results is presented. This work provides a concrete example to allow academics and engineers to systematically choose a discretisation method.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

The complexity of current and emerging architectures provides users with options about how best to use the available resources, but makes predicting performance challenging. In this work a benchmark-driven model is developed for a simple shallow water code on a Cray XE6 system, to explore how deployment choices such as domain decomposition and core affinity affect performance. The resource sharing present in modern multi-core architectures adds various levels of heterogeneity to the system. Shared resources often includes cache, memory, network controllers and in some cases floating point units (as in the AMD Bulldozer), which mean that the access time depends on the mapping of application tasks, and the core's location within the system. Heterogeneity further increases with the use of hardware-accelerators such as GPUs and the Intel Xeon Phi, where many specialist cores are attached to general-purpose cores. This trend for shared resources and non-uniform cores is expected to continue into the exascale era. The complexity of these systems means that various runtime scenarios are possible, and it has been found that under-populating nodes, altering the domain decomposition and non-standard task to core mappings can dramatically alter performance. To find this out, however, is often a process of trial and error. To better inform this process, a performance model was developed for a simple regular grid-based kernel code, shallow. The code comprises two distinct types of work, loop-based array updates and nearest-neighbour halo-exchanges. Separate performance models were developed for each part, both based on a similar methodology. Application specific benchmarks were run to measure performance for different problem sizes under different execution scenarios. These results were then fed into a performance model that derives resource usage for a given deployment scenario, with interpolation between results as necessary.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

John Searle’s Chinese Room Argument (CRA) purports to demonstrate that syntax is not sufficient for semantics, and, hence, because computation cannot yield understanding, the computational theory of mind, which equates the mind to an information processing system based on formal computations, fails. In this paper, we use the CRA, and the debate that emerged from it, to develop a philosophical critique of recent advances in robotics and neuroscience. We describe results from a body of work that contributes to blurring the divide between biological and artificial systems; so-called animats, autonomous robots that are controlled by biological neural tissue and what may be described as remote-controlled rodents, living animals endowed with augmented abilities provided by external controllers. We argue that, even though at first sight, these chimeric systems may seem to escape the CRA, on closer analysis, they do not. We conclude by discussing the role of the body–brain dynamics in the processes that give rise to genuine understanding of the world, in line with recent proposals from enactive cognitive science.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This report discusses developing a software log tool for analysis of industrial processes. The target was to develop software that can help electro Engineers for monitor and fault finding in industrial processes. The tool is called PLS (Process log server), and is developed in Visual Studio.NET Framework 2005. PLS works as a client with Beijer Electronics OPC Server. The program is able to read data from PLC (Programmable Logic Controller), trough the OPC Server. PLS connects to all kind of controllers that is supported by the Beijer Electronics OPC Server. Signal data is stored in a database for later analysis. Chosen signals data can easily be exported into a text file. The text file is adopted for import to MS Office Excel. User manual [UM-07] is written as a separate document. The software acted stable through the function test. The final product becomes a first-rate tool that is simple to use. As an advantage, the software can be developed with more functions in the future.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This report presents a new way of control engineering. Dc motor speed controlled by three controllers PID, pole placement and Fuzzy controller and discusses the advantages and disadvantages of each controller for different conditions under loaded and unloaded scenarios using software Matlab. The brushless series wound Dc motor is very popular in industrial application and control systems because of the high torque density, high efficiency and small size. First suitable equations are developed for DC motor. PID controller is developed and tuned in order to get faster step response. The simulation results of PID controller provide very good results and the controller is further tuned in order to decrease its overshoot error which is common in PID controllers. Further it is purposed that in industrial environment these controllers are better than others controllers as PID controllers are easy to tuned and cheap. Pole placement controller is the best example of control engineering. An addition of integrator reduced the noise disturbances in pole placement controller and this makes it a good choice for industrial applications. The fuzzy controller is introduce with a DC chopper to make the DC motor speed control smooth and almost no steady state error is observed. Another advantage is achieved in fuzzy controller that the simulations of three different controllers are compared and concluded from the results that Fuzzy controller outperforms to PID controller in terms of steady state error and smooth step response. While Pole placement controller have no comparison in terms of controls because designer can change the step response according to nature of control systems, so this controller provide wide range of control over a system. Poles location change the step response in a sense that if poles are near to origin then step response of motor is fast. Finally a GUI of these three controllers are developed which allow the user to select any controller and change its parameters according to the situation.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

In this study the monitoring results of prototype installation of a recently developed solar combisystem have been evaluated. The system, that uses a water jacketed pellet stove as auxiliary heater, was installed in a single family house in Borlänge/Sweden. In order to allow an evaluation under realistic conditions the system has been monitored for a time period of one year. From the measurements of the system it could be seen that it is important that the pellet stove has a sufficient buffer store volume to minimize cycling. The measurements showed also that the stove gives a lower share of the produced heat to the water loop than measured under stationary conditions. The solar system works as expected and covers the heat demand during the summer and a part of the heat demand during spring and autumn. Potential for optimization exists for the parasitic electricity demand. The system consumes 680 kWh per year for pumps, valves and controllers which is more than 4% of the total primary heating energy demand.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This thesis presents the study and development of fault-tolerant techniques for programmable architectures, the well-known Field Programmable Gate Arrays (FPGAs), customizable by SRAM. FPGAs are becoming more valuable for space applications because of the high density, high performance, reduced development cost and re-programmability. In particular, SRAM-based FPGAs are very valuable for remote missions because of the possibility of being reprogrammed by the user as many times as necessary in a very short period. SRAM-based FPGA and micro-controllers represent a wide range of components in space applications, and as a result will be the focus of this work, more specifically the Virtex® family from Xilinx and the architecture of the 8051 micro-controller from Intel. The Triple Modular Redundancy (TMR) with voters is a common high-level technique to protect ASICs against single event upset (SEU) and it can also be applied to FPGAs. The TMR technique was first tested in the Virtex® FPGA architecture by using a small design based on counters. Faults were injected in all sensitive parts of the FPGA and a detailed analysis of the effect of a fault in a TMR design synthesized in the Virtex® platform was performed. Results from fault injection and from a radiation ground test facility showed the efficiency of the TMR for the related case study circuit. Although TMR has showed a high reliability, this technique presents some limitations, such as area overhead, three times more input and output pins and, consequently, a significant increase in power dissipation. Aiming to reduce TMR costs and improve reliability, an innovative high-level technique for designing fault-tolerant systems in SRAM-based FPGAs was developed, without modification in the FPGA architecture. This technique combines time and hardware redundancy to reduce overhead and to ensure reliability. It is based on duplication with comparison and concurrent error detection. The new technique proposed in this work was specifically developed for FPGAs to cope with transient faults in the user combinational and sequential logic, while also reducing pin count, area and power dissipation. The methodology was validated by fault injection experiments in an emulation board. The thesis presents comparison results in fault coverage, area and performance between the discussed techniques.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

This study analyzes the possibility of organizational change in the security activity in organizations, assuming a new paradigm: management of risks and loss prevention. Based in this, two different analytical problems had structuralized the research: A) To demonstrate the absence of an activity regulated between the public and private security, presenting as it is played and justifying by means of historical and methodological aspects the responsibility of the actors on the losses generated for the current form of management; B) the challenge of the management of risks and loss prevention, leaving of the estimated one that the acceptability of treatment of the risks is based not only by the evaluation technique, but mainly in the involved intuitive aspects in the decision made. In general lines, the intention to carry through a theoretical quarrel and an analysis of the speech of controllers of organizations, to the end, is to arrive at the conclusion of that if it cannot more admit the different sides of security and a bigger universe, where if does not have to look for to only decide the urgent problem, but also to participate and to contribute in the life of the organization, by means of a cycle of accompaniment of risks based in preventive activities. Moreover, a new involved approach in the process of understanding of the heuristically ones of the organization brings the possibility of uneven benefits in that it concerns to provide actions that if locate inside of one continuum, whose extremities are in playing activities with a maximum degree of risks displaying the life of the organization the concretion of a starter fact of damages and keeping the activity end of the organization stopped in the search of a degree of risk next to zero.

Relevância:

10.00% 10.00%

Publicador:

Resumo:

O objetivo desta pesquisa foi averiguar partir da análise do modelo de performance social corporativa, tomando como base proposta de classificação dos conceitos que circunscrevem as "dimensões sociais do marketing", inseridos nos espaços estruturais do mapa de estruturaação das sociedades capitalistas no sistema mundial, se as práticas dessas ferramentas gerenciais por FURNAS Centrais Elétricas SA estão mais afinadas com preceitos regulatórios, ligados ao mercado, ou emancipatórios, ligados ao espírito público. Para tanto se realizou uma revisão da bibliografia referente ao assunto objetivando enquadrar as empresas na atual conjuntura sócio-econômica, aprofundar conhecimento concernente evolução do conceito de responsabilidade social corporativa, esclarecer emaranhado conceituai que envolve as ferramentas que compõem as "dimensões sociais do marketing" propor análise do uso de tais ferramentas sob enfoque da Teoria Crítica. Usou-se como método estudo de caso, os resultados foram obtidos a partir da análise livre do discurso de dirigentes, conseguidos por meio de entrevistas semi-estruturadas, dos documentos disponibilizados pela empresa. Os dados revelam que prática das ferramentas que compõem as "dimensões sociais do marketing" por FURNAS Centrais Elétricas SA estão mais voltadas para legitimação da empresa, que para obter vantagem competitiva, de onde se conclui que está mais relacionada ao espírito público, denotando, por conseguinte, práticas substantivas.